Kale was exploring the day he was born. This big boy is going places. He likes to be held and he likes to strut about.

Available for pre-adoption applications!
At 6 weeks old this bundle of joy had his first set up puppy shots and de-wormer. He will received his second puppy shot and deworming in a couple of weeks. Then the fun begins as he will be ready to enjoy all the puppy love you can give him.

After he arrives home APAC will cover his 3rd puppy shot, rabies shot, spay, microchipping and 6 months of heartworm preventative. All services must be completed at APACs vet of choice Animal Medical Care of Temple.

All this is for a fee of $215 with a $40 refund upon the completion of her spay. Please visit our website at www.myhappytail.org and complete the adoption application.
